Special Bridge Design and Construction Trends

The global special bridge design and construction market is valued at USD 88.3 billion in 2023 and is expected to grow to USD 120.1 billion by 2028, exhibiting a CAGR of 6.5% during the forecast period. The growth of this market is attributed to the increasing demand for new bridges, the need for the rehabilitation and replacement of aging bridges, and the growing adoption of advanced technologies in bridge design and construction.

Some key trends in the special bridge design and construction market include:

  • The increasing use of prefabricated bridge elements, which can reduce construction time and costs.
  • The use of new materials and technologies, such as fiber-reinforced polymers (FRPs) and high-performance concrete, which can improve the durability and longevity of bridges.
  • The development of new bridge designs, such as cable-stayed bridges and suspension bridges, which can be used to span longer distances.
  • The adoption of digital technologies, such as building information modeling (BIM) and drones, which can improve the planning, design, and construction of bridges.

Challenges and Restraints in Special Bridge Design and Construction

The special bridge design and construction market also faces several challenges and restraints. These include:

  • The high cost of bridge construction, which can make it difficult to justify the investment in new bridges.
  • The complexity of bridge design and construction, which requires specialized expertise and experience.
  • The environmental impact of bridge construction, which can disrupt ecosystems and harm wildlife.
  • The need for long-term maintenance and repair, which can be costly and time-consuming.
